Optimize enterprise technology performance with cloud architectures built for predictable growth
Enterprise tech platforms need solutions that reduce integration friction, create flexible environments, and keep operations reliable at scale.
Cross-platform integration fabric
Unifies APIs, services, and legacy systems into a cohesive layer. Eliminates delivery delays caused by fragmented platforms.
On-demand environment provisioning
Generates dev, test, and staging environments through Infrastructure as Code. Maintains consistency across teams while compressing release timelines.
Workload segmentation and isolation
Assigns guaranteed resources and SLAs to critical apps while containing experimental workloads. Prevents over-allocation without sacrificing performance.
Predictive failure analysis
Uses telemetry and ML to anticipate degradation before downtime occurs. Shifts reliability from reactive fixes to proactive stability.
Data residency and sovereignty controls
Applies region-specific storage, encryption, and auditing. Simplifies compliance with GDPR, HIPAA, and other regulations without duplicate deployments.
Portfolio-level cost modeling
Maps cloud consumption across services and business units. Aligns budgets with actual usage to keep growth financially predictable.
